For Saquon Barkley, walking out of the home tunnel at Lincoln Financial Field for the first time was more than just another moment in his career—it was a homecoming. Amidst the incredible roar of over 50,000 fervent fans during the Eagles' open practice, Barkley felt a surge of nostalgia and connection that transcended his professional journey.

Lincoln Financial Field, a majestic stadium located 200 miles southeast of Beaver Stadium, holds a special place in Barkley's heart. As he reminisced about his collegiate days, the euphoria of the moment became palpable. “I tell these guys it's like college. If you think about it, when you leave college, the NFL is on another level with the stadiums and the vibe. You never really get that college feeling, but you get that here,” Barkley shared, his voice filled with enthusiasm.

Indeed, for Barkley, emerging from the visitors’ tunnel as a Penn State player and later as a member of the New York Giants was vastly different compared to the electric reception he experienced here. The Eagles' open practice, which has consistently grown to accommodate over 50,000 fans in recent years, manifests a unique ambiance that evokes memories of college football’s glory days.

Trevor Keegan, another player who felt the intensity of the atmosphere, described his awe with striking clarity. “It was awesome. I remember walking out there and they're introducing all the guys, I'm like 'Holy shit, this is so cool.'” The sentiment was echoed by the crowd’s energy, which Keegan found even more overpowering than Michigan Stadium’s legendary roar. “It was louder than Michigan Stadium with those 50,000 people. It was rocking,” he added.

The open practice crowd at Lincoln Financial Field isn't just a testament to the city's love for football—it represents Philadelphia's passionate and loyal fan base. This unity among players and supporters fosters a deeply motivating environment. Barkley noted, “I already knew how much love this city has, not just for this team, but all the teams around here. But for a practice to have 50,000 fans is truly insane. It helps us as a team. It kind of gives me that college feel again.”

The parallels between the NFL and collegiate atmospheres were more than evident to Barkley. Reflecting on his days at Beaver Stadium, he articulated the intensity and importance of each game. “When I was in college, you didn't want anyone to come into Beaver Stadium and get a win there. You get that feel here. You know how much every week is, and how much that means, when you play at the Linc,” Barkley said.
